The basic Sales Tax rate in Florida is 6.0% and is on most goods and services. The counties have an option, by vote of their residents, to add a surtax of 0.5%, 1.0% or 1.5% to the state rate.
Orange County, which is most of WDW has a surtax of 0.5%, so purchases (including meals) are taxed at 6.5%.
Osceola County, which has the All-Stars Resorts and Wide World of Sports in it, has a 1.0% surtax so purchases at those locations are subject to a 7.0% tax.
In addition, counties are allowed to have a tax on transient lodging. In Orange it is 5.0% through August 31 then 6.0, so the room tax at almost all of WDW is 11.5% and 12.5% on/after September 1. In Osceola it is 6.0%, so the room tax at the All-Stars Resorts is 13.0%.
